## 2.9.1 — Key rotation + encoding detection

Quick one for the security folks: Textloom's upload pipeline now runs proper encoding detection on text files instead of assuming UTF-8 and praying. We sniff BOMs, fall back to statistical detection, and reject anything we can't confidently classify — no more mojibake sneaking into the Harrowgate index. As part of this release we also rotated the artifact signing key, since the old one was approaching its expiry window. Verify new builds against the key below.

deploy key for kajof-fajop: bky6_gDHw9Q

Hey — handing off the gateway rate-limiting work before I'm out. The Brindlegate gateway now enforces per-tenant token buckets instead of the old global cap, so the noisy batch clients can't starve everyone else. It's been stable in staging for two weeks. For the release, the only thing you need to double-check is that prod ships with the limiter settings we agreed on, which are these.

settings of yahof-tageg:
[praath]
port = 5672
region = north-1
host = praath.norvacorp.internal
timeout_ms = 500
retries = 2

Blue-green deploys for the Tallgrass billing worker run twice weekly. Green pool takes traffic only after the ledger reconciliation check passes. If invoices stall mid-cutover, do not roll back manually — the worker drains queued charges first. Flip the router flag, wait five minutes, verify counts match. Escalate to the Meridian payments rota if drift exceeds ten records. Full cutover steps are documented here.

operations page: https://jenkins.zemvarcloud.local/job/merge_requests/repo/build/73930b4b30f0a8ed

Handover note — Proctorline queue

For the sync: handing the exam-proctoring queue from me to Darya. Current state is stable; the backlog spike from last week cleared after we raised worker concurrency. One open item: session-expiry retries occasionally double-enqueue, tracked in the backlog. Alerting thresholds were retuned Thursday and should not need touching. The queue currently runs with the values below.

settings of yajog-bageg:
[drudor]
host = drudor.paliqworks.internal
user = drudor_svc
database = drudor_prod